@morgancampbell , In this Please, move week, week rank to week table. Create a Separate Week/date table have week Rank there.
That is the best way to make it work.
TWER % LWER =
VAR TWER = CALCULATE(sum('Table'[Email Read]), FILTER(ALL('Week'),'Week'[Week Rank]=max('Week'[Week Rank])))
RETURN
VAR LWER = CALCULATE(sum('Table'[Email Read]), FILTER(ALL('Week'),'Week'[Week Rank]=max('Week'[Week Rank])-1))
RETURN
( IF(
NOT ISBLANK(TWER),
DIVIDE(TWER - LWER, LWER)
)
)
